dc.description.abstractIn this research, the Generalized Special Relativity (GSR) formula is utilized to calculate the mass of the neutral pion particle, the result found is compared to the value calculated using the half life time method, which derived from the relationship between the half life time and the frequency of spectrum of the particle, also we found that the calculated values of the mass are n conformity with the theoretical and applied values for this particle.en_US
